Great win for England 6-2 against Iran
England won the first match of the 2022 Football World Cup with 6 goals to 2 today (21).
It is against Iran.
B group matches of the tournament started today.
Accordingly, in the first match of that group, England, which is ranked 5th in the world, and Iran, which is ranked 20th, joined in the first match.
From the start of the match held at the Khalifa International Stadium, Iran faced a strong challenge from the England team.
England started the scoring in the match.
Accordingly, Jude Bellingham scored the first goal for England in the 35th minute of the match.
They scored their second goal 8 minutes later.
Saka scored that goal.
England scored the third goal in injury time at the end of the first half.
Sterling managed to score that goal.
Accordingly, at the end of the first half, England was in a strong position with 3 goals to 0.
In the second half, English players spread their command and Saka scored the second goal of that team in the 62nd minute.
Xhaka became the youngest player to score more than one goal for England in a World Cup match today.
Taremmi scored the first goal for Iran in the 65th minute of the match.
England scored the fifth goal in the 71st minute.
England scored the 6th goal in the 89th minute of the match.
However, the number of goals in Iran became 2 with the success of the penalty kick given at the end of the match.
Mehdi Taremmi succeeded in the penalty kick.
Accordingly, England won the match with 6 goals to 2 goals.
